Self Service Car Washes in SoCal

Looking for good Self-Service Car Washes in SoCal, in addition to the thread on Laser Car Washes.

If you search the Internet or youtube you will be jealous how nice some of
Self-Service Car Washes are around the USA and around the World, compared to LA/CA. Some are in-door and heated during the winter.



It is also important to have an air compressor option to blow water out of the crevices. It is sometimes called an Air Squeegee.

Poor guy needs a bigger microfiber drying towel and/or leaf blower.
Drying agent like P&S Beadmaker would be a good idea.

The one thing I am looking for is a Self-Service Car Wash that might let you bring your own pressure washer wand and foam cannon, so you can use your own advanced auto detailing products.

Also look for a self-service car wash that takes credit cards. Most sites only accept small bills and coins...I thought it was 2020.

You can try "no rinse" or "waterless" car washing, search on youtube. It's what I've been using since about 2016 on my cars and i've gotten complements from service people who can't believe it has > 100k miles. It's not really waterless, but you don't rinse the car off with a hose. I probably use about 4 gallons of water, of which 1 or 2 ends up on the ground and the rest has the dirt in it and is discarded.
